1. Anthem Sports & Entertainment Executives
Anthem Sports & Entertainment is the parent company of TNA Wrestling (now branded as Impact Wrestling). Anthem’s executives play a crucial role in the decisions that shape TNA’s future. They oversee finances, broadcasting rights, and partnerships, ensuring that the company remains profitable and can continue to deliver high-quality wrestling entertainment.
2. Scott D’Amore – EVP of Impact Wrestling
As the Executive Vice President of Impact Wrestling, Scott D’Amore has a massive influence on the day-to-day operations and creative direction of TNA. With a deep understanding of wrestling and a track record of success as a promoter, D’Amore is responsible for making key decisions about talent, storylines, and show production. His experience in the wrestling industry makes him a crucial asset to the TNA Board.
3. Ed Nordholm – President of Anthem Wrestling Exhibitions
Ed Nordholm oversees the wrestling division of Anthem and is instrumental in managing the business side of TNA. He plays a major role in shaping TNA’s strategic direction, handling negotiations with broadcasters, and forming partnerships that help the company grow. Nordholm’s background in business and law gives him the skills needed to navigate the complex world of sports entertainment.
